About Montessori of Woodridge
Montessori of Woodridge, located in Woodridge, IL, is a private school that operates independently of the Woodridge public school system. Private Schools receive funding through tuition, student fees, and private contributions. The Private School has selective admissions and can choose who to admit as a student.
